At this time of year many might be stressed because we are approaching the end of the financial year. Rather than stress over it, take the opportunity to examine your numbers and use them to determine your next steps.

Business is fairly simple as long as you understand a few basics and all the answers are in the numbers – as long as you know how to interpret them.

  • What are your Strengths, Weaknesses, Opportunities & Threats?
  • Clarity – What is your Plan? Ideally, this will be written as it is the road map for where you want to go and how you aim to get there.
  • Knowledge – What do your numbers tell you?
  • If you don’t know how to interpret them, find someone who does and get their help. Understanding your numbers makes business management a much easier task.
  • Simplicity – Keep it as simple as you possibly can.
